Introduction to Wieland RST Series

The Wieland RST series represents a modular, pre-wired connector solution designed for fast, reliable, and tool-free installation in modern industrial and commercial environments. Used globally in power distribution systems, lighting, and automation networks, the RST series offers a plug-and-play approach to electrical installations. The product family includes the RST MICRO, MINI, and CLASSIC systems, each tailored for specific voltage, current rating, and application demands.
With a wide range of sizes, pole configurations, and IP-rated protection levels, Wieland RST connectors are ideal for both permanent and temporary installations in harsh environments. IP Rating and Waterproof Capabilities
All RST connectors are engineered to meet stringent environmental protection standards. With IP66, IP68, and IP69K ratings, the series guarantees resistance to water jets, submersion, and high-pressure cleaning processes, making them ideal for outdoor lighting, tunnels, and industrial washdown areas.
These waterproof modular connectors ensure reliable long-term operation in exposed conditions, reducing downtime and minimizing the risk of short circuits. The housing construction ensures a tight seal, essential for preventing ingress in critical power distribution systems.
Contact Sealing Mechanisms
Wieland RST uses integrated contact sealing technology to protect electrical connections from dust, moisture, and contaminants. The advanced sealing elements—built into both the male and female connector halves—ensure uninterrupted conductivity and extend the system’s operational life.
These contact seals are especially valuable in power connectors exposed to variable environments, such as construction sites or decentralized machine networks.
Quick-Release Mechanisms
The RST series incorporates quick-release and locking mechanisms to simplify installation and disconnection without specialized tools. This feature speeds up service and commissioning work while maintaining high safety and reliability.
The connectors are designed to support secure connections even when under vibration or mechanical stress, ideal for mobile equipment, production machinery, and modular wiring architectures. Their reinforced housings provide excellent mechanical strength in demanding applications.

The RST® MICRO Connector
The RST MICRO is one of the smallest waterproof connectors on the market, designed for low-voltage sensor and control applications. With a cable diameter of just 6–9 mm and IP66/IP68 protection, it’s perfect for LED lighting systems, signage, and compact automation modules.
Despite its size, it supports up to 250 V and 8 A, providing a reliable and compact solution for tight installation spaces. These compact designs make the MICRO an excellent choice for space-constrained applications where durability and current rating are still critical.
